在虚拟现实(VR)技术的飞速发展下,VR界面设计成为了打造沉浸式体验的关键。一个优秀的VR界面设计不仅能提升用户体验,还能让虚拟世界更加真实和互动。以下将介绍五款必备的VR界面设计软件,帮助您打造出令人印象深刻的VR体验。
1. Unity
Unity是一款功能强大的游戏开发引擎,广泛应用于VR游戏和应用程序的开发。它提供了丰富的3D图形渲染、物理引擎和交互功能,使得开发者能够轻松构建复杂的三维场景和交互界面。
Unity优势:
- 跨平台支持:支持多个平台,包括PC、移动设备和VR头盔。
- 强大的图形渲染:提供高质量的3D渲染效果,支持实时渲染和离线渲染。
- 丰富的插件生态:拥有庞大的插件市场,可以扩展Unity的功能。
应用案例:
Unity被广泛应用于VR游戏开发,如《Beat Saber》和《Half-Life: Alyx》等。
2. Unreal Engine
Unreal Engine是另一款备受推崇的游戏开发引擎,以其出色的图形渲染和物理模拟功能而闻名。它适合开发高质量的VR游戏和应用程序。
Unreal Engine优势:
- 高级图形渲染:支持实时渲染和离线渲染,提供高质量的视觉效果。
- 物理引擎:提供强大的物理模拟功能,使得虚拟世界更加真实。
- 蓝图系统:无需编写代码,即可通过可视化编程构建游戏逻辑。
应用案例:
Unreal Engine常用于开发VR游戏,如《VRChat》和《The Lab》等。
3. Blender
Blender是一款开源的三维建模、动画和渲染软件,适合初学者和专业人士。它提供了一套完整的VR界面设计工具,可以帮助开发者快速构建VR场景和交互界面。
Blender优势:
- 开源免费:免费使用,无需付费。
- 功能全面:提供建模、雕刻、动画、渲染等功能。
- 社区支持:拥有庞大的社区,可以获取丰富的教程和资源。
应用案例:
Blender常用于制作VR短片和动画,如《Big Buck Hunter VR》和《The Witness》等。
4. Adobe Photoshop
Adobe Photoshop是一款著名的图像处理软件,广泛应用于平面设计、摄影和UI设计等领域。它也提供了VR界面设计的功能,可以帮助设计师创建高质量的VR图像和视觉效果。
Photoshop优势:
- 强大的图像处理能力:提供丰富的图像编辑和合成工具。
- 插件支持:可以安装各种插件来扩展功能。
- 社区资源:拥有丰富的社区资源和教程。
应用案例:
Photoshop常用于设计VR游戏和应用程序的UI界面,如《Beat Saber》和《The Lab》等。
5. SketchUp
SketchUp是一款简单易用的三维建模软件,适合建筑师、设计师和爱好者。它提供了VR界面设计的功能,可以帮助用户快速构建VR场景和交互界面。
SketchUp优势:
- 易用性:简单易学,适合初学者。
- 实时渲染:提供实时渲染功能,可以快速预览设计效果。
- 插件支持:可以安装各种插件来扩展功能。
应用案例:
SketchUp常用于设计室内VR全景效果图,如《火星时代教育问答》中提到的案例。
通过掌握以上五款必备的VR界面设计软件,您可以轻松打造出沉浸式的VR体验。在VR技术不断发展的今天,优秀的VR界面设计将成为您在竞争激烈的市场中脱颖而出的关键。